Nintendo Treehouse: Live @ E3 2016 will heavily feature Zelda Wii U later this month. However, as it turns out, that won’t be the only game on the broadcast.

The official Japanese Twitter account for Pokemon confirms that Pokemon Sun/Moon and Pokemon GO will be included in the Nintendo Treehouse: Live @ E3 2016 live stream. We don’t know what exactly will be shown, but this is rather interesting news!

On Tuesday, Pokemon Sun/Moon will be introduced (June 14). Pokemon GO will be featured on Wednesday (June 15). Guests such as developers will stop by, and there will also be new information and trivia about development that can only be heard here. With Pokemon GO, it will be a developer Q&A.

Also a bit of an aside but:

So Hau's favorite treat is very much a real thing: malasadas are a Portuguese doughnut hole coated in granulated sugar that was brought over to the islands.

I thought the Steel typing was weird too, but let me direct you to this.

It's a bit of a long article, but tl;dr, stars are not just comprised of hydrogen and helium but also out of various metals, and some of these stars, known as Population I stars, are particularly metal-rich.

In fact, our own sun is a Population I star!

Whee, thanks for all the info everyone~! Now, my thoughts:

- From left to right, it looks like the islands are Niihau (that really small thing), Kauai, Oahu, I guess some smooshed-up representation of Maui County (that's Maui, Lanai, and Molokai, but I'm having problems identifying it, would like a little help here please), and Hawaii.

- The Japanese trailer captured a bit of speech from Lillie/Hau. Lillie's speech is what you'd expect from a quiet girl who just met someone. Hau's speech pattern is. . .kind of hard to explain. It's a bit more singsong and definitely more laid back. Someone did their language homework!

- However, I see shoes being worn in houses. It's customary to take off shoes before entering a house in Hawaii. But I suspect that would be somewhat of a pain to program!

- I don't have a problem with the Japanese-style buildings, as they exist in Hawaii right alongside everything else. For example, the Japanese Chamber of Commerce is pretty close to a Burger King.

- The two clouded regions should be interesting. Perhaps one of 'em will be Kaho'olawe (minus the unexploded ordinance).

- OMG MALASADAS! Yes, they're delicious, go eat a few.

- Oh, right, the legendaries. The actual moves look cool, and I like the thought of being able to one-shot Sturdy 'mons.
